Career path

Career Role: Cybersecurity Incident Responder (GDPR Focus) Description
Cybersecurity Analyst - GDPR Compliance Investigates and responds to data breaches, ensuring compliance with GDPR regulations. Focuses on data loss prevention and recovery. High demand.
GDPR Compliance Officer - Incident Response Manages the organization's response to security incidents, ensuring all actions align with GDPR requirements. Leads incident investigations and reporting. Strong leadership skills required.
Data Protection Officer (DPO) - Incident Response Specialist A senior role requiring deep understanding of GDPR and incident response. Oversees all aspects of data protection and incident management. Expert-level knowledge needed.
Forensic Investigator - GDPR Specialist Conducts forensic investigations into data breaches, identifying the root cause and impact. Provides expert testimony and reports, ensuring compliance with legal and GDPR requirements. High level of technical expertise essential.

Why this course?

A Postgraduate Certificate in Cybersecurity Incident Response Analysis is increasingly significant for GDPR compliance in today's UK market. The UK's Information Commissioner's Office (ICO) reported a 41% increase in data breaches in 2022, highlighting the growing need for skilled professionals. This surge underscores the critical role of effective incident response in mitigating the financial and reputational damage associated with non-compliance. The ability to quickly identify, contain, and remediate data breaches is paramount to satisfying GDPR's stringent requirements, including notification deadlines and data subject rights.

This postgraduate certificate equips individuals with the advanced knowledge and practical skills required for effective incident response. It addresses current trends, such as sophisticated ransomware attacks and the rise of cloud-based data breaches. Understanding methodologies like the NIST Cybersecurity Framework and ISO 27001 standards is crucial, as is mastering forensic techniques and data recovery strategies. Graduates are better equipped to navigate the complex regulatory landscape and reduce an organization's GDPR breach liability.
